Ordinals
beta
Sat 687665216149188
decimal
137533.216149188
degree
0°137533′445″216149188‴
percentile
32.745962709791435%
name
izcdpwajwjl
cycle
0
epoch
0
period
68
block
137533
offset
216149188
timestamp
2011-07-22 20:18:23 UTC
rarity
common
prev
next